There are some good recipes online...just search whatever you’re making with instapot.

I‘ve used it to make some really good vegetable beef soup and chicken soup.

They’re pretty cool to use and certainly cut down the time needed to make something. Although waiting for the pressure to release can take some time. Of course you can release it manually, but I like to let it sit for a while.
